## Formula sandbox tuning

User-supplied formulas in Gridmoor execute inside a restricted interpreter with hard ceilings on time, memory, and call depth. Reviewers should confirm any change to these ceilings is justified in the PR description, since raising them widens the abuse surface. Defaults were chosen from production traces. The current limits are as follows.

limits module of tafog-fawip:
WEIGHTS = {
    "julix": 57,
    "lamys": 992,
    "kasvan": 209,
    "quenok": 750,
    "alddor": 259,
    "oliath": 1009,
    "wenix": 815,
}

Crestkit uses strict semver. Breaking prop changes = major bump, no exceptions. Consumers pin minor versions; the Relay team auto-upgrades patches nightly. If a release breaks a downstream build, revert the publish, don't hotfix forward. Changelogs are generated from commit prefixes — bad prefixes mean missing changelog entries, so check before merging. Publishing requires auth against the internal package registry via the publisher service account. Set the registry token in your environment using the key below.

service key, yadug-bajog: zpat3_pou

## First-Aid Room

The first-aid room at Osprey Court is on the ground floor, just past the kitchenette. It's kept locked so the supplies don't wander off, but any team assistant can open it in an emergency. Restock requests go to the facilities inbox tray, and please log anything you use. To unlock the door, tap in the code below.

door code, yagap-bahof: bdg-O-05

Subject: Cache invalidation on Lumicart catalog sync

Hi Brindle Systems team,

Per our security review prep: Lumicart now emits invalidation events within 200ms of any SKU mutation, and stale reads are capped at one minute. Please verify your edge nodes honor the purge headers. For staging verification, use the token below.

portal login ticket: eyJhbGciOiJIUzI1NiIsInR5cCI6IkpXVCJ9.eyJzdWIiOiIwEOsktwVNwIn0.-UJU3fdyyCgG